A Celebration of Life will be held for Cheryl Denise Jones at her family home located at 21301 SR 530 NE Arlington, WA 98223 on May 30th, 2015 at 1:00 PM. Anyone who knew her and would like to come is welcome.

Cheryl was born on December 7th, 1970 at 7:42 AM in Port Angeles, WA to William and Robin Schostak. Ten years later she was joined by her sister, Kimberly Schostak.

She was a very special woman who loved and supported her husband Jim, son Kyten, and daughters Chalaine (Laney) and Makiah each and every day. Cheryl and Jim were married on April 28th, 1990 at the Assembly of God Church in Forks, WA.

Cheryl left us peacefully at the age of 44 while at the University of Washington Hospital on Thursday May 21st, 2015 with her family by her side. Cheryl fought hard for 5 months against the genetic Alpha One Antitrypsin Deficiency, while waiting for a liver transplant.

Cheryl was well known for her many talents; some of which included, taking excellent care of her family, gardening, cooking, and canning. One of her favorite holiday traditions was making homemade Christmas baskets that were gifted to many family and friends. She also valued the extensive amount of time she spent volunteering at her children’s schools. Cheryl cherished the time she spent watching and supporting her husband and son in many years at the race track.

The family would like to give a heartfelt thank you to everyone who supported the GoFundMe account. Cheryl enjoyed reading the names and comments of everyone who donated in honor of her. The family would also like to thank fellow racers, who donated their race winnings and are raffling a vintage modified racecar to support Cheryl and her family in return for the many years of her devotion towards the whole club. An additional fundraiser is being held in her home town of Forks which will include a spaghetti dinner and a silent auction.
